Under Maine law, many adults are required by statute to report knowledge or reasonable suspicion of elder abuse, neglect, or exploitation. These mandated reporters include many persons working in professional capacities that regularly or sometimes interact with the elderly. WebNov 1, 2003 · A substantiation means DHHS found you were responsible for a child who was abused or neglected. The abuse or neglect must be “high severity.”. Parents and other caretakers can be substantiated.
